  • 18 November 2022 MD Medical Group Investments Plc (MD Medical Group, MDMG, Group or the Company; LSE and MOEX: MDMG), a leading Russian private healthcare provider, today announces the launch of a new out-patient clinic with a focus on IVF in Yekaterinburg.
  • The new clinic has been created in line with MD Medical Groups customary high standards of medical care and is fitted with world-class equipment produced by GE, Medtronic, ALscope and Olympus.
  • Today, MD Medical Group is expanding its presence and entering a new location the Sverdlovsk region, the largest and most dynamically developing region of the Ural Federal District.

The majority of the convenience stores are located in Moscow / Moscow region (1,329 outlets) and St.Petersburg / Leningrad region (458 outlets).

Key Points: 
  • The majority of the convenience stores are located in Moscow / Moscow region (1,329 outlets) and St.Petersburg / Leningrad region (458 outlets).
  • The remainder of the stores in the convenience format are located in the Central, North-West and Urals federal districts.
  • 90% of the selling space in the convenience format is rented, while 74% of the selling space in the superstore format is owned.
  • High-quality locations, well-known brand and strong customer base in Moscow and St.Petersburg will allow Magnit to become one of the top-players in the respective regions.
